SSH Anahtar Oluşturma ve Kullanma
SSH anahtar çifti oluşturun ve sunuculara şifresiz güvenli bağlantı kurun.
Kurulum Adımları
1. SSH anahtar çifti oluşturun:
ssh-keygen -t ed25519 -C "email@ornek.com"2. Varsayılan konumu kabul edin (~/.ssh/id_ed25519)
3. Passphrase belirleyin (önerilir)
4. Public anahtarı görüntüleyin:
cat ~/.ssh/id_ed25519.pub5. Anahtarı sunucuya kopyalayın:
ssh-copy-id -i ~/.ssh/id_ed25519.pub kullanici@sunucu_ip6. Artık şifresiz bağlanabilirsiniz:
ssh kullanici@sunucu_ip7. SSH config dosyası oluşturun (~/.ssh/config):
Host sunucum
HostName 192.168.1.100
User kullanici
Port 22
IdentityFile ~/.ssh/id_ed255198. Artık kısa komutla bağlanın:
ssh sunucum9. SSH agent kullanımı:
eval "$(ssh-agent -s)"
ssh-add ~/.ssh/id_ed2551910. GitHub'a SSH key ekleyin:
GitHub > Settings > SSH and GPG keys > New SSH key
İlgili Rehberler
Git ve GitHub Kurulumu
Git versiyon kontrol sistemini kurun ve GitHub ile projeleri yönetin.
VS Code Kurulumu ve Eklentiler
Visual Studio Code editörünü kurun ve geliştirici eklentileriyle güçlendirin.
PM2 ile Node.js Uygulama Yönetimi
PM2 process manager ile Node.js uygulamalarınızı production'da yönetin.
GitHub Actions CI/CD Kurulumu
GitHub Actions ile otomatik test, build ve deploy pipeline'ı oluşturun.